II. Historic Evolution of Advertising

A. Early Forms of Advertising

Advertising, in different types, has been an essential part of human history because ancient times. Early civilizations used primary techniques to promote goods and services, leveraging standard interaction techniques to reach potential clients. Some early types of advertising include:

  • Pictorial Signage: In ancient marketplaces, traders used pictorial indications and symbols to identify their shops and show the items they offered. These visual hints served as an early form of branding and assisted illiterate people acknowledge businesses.
  • Town Criers: In middle ages Europe, town criers played an essential function in distributing info and advertising occasions. They would openly announce news, proclamations, and spot announcements, acting as human "speakers" for organizations and authorities.
  •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ters became popular advertising tools. These promotional materials were plastered on walls, trees, and other public areas to notify the regional community about items, services, and events.

B. The Birth of Modern Advertising

The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century brought about significant changes to the advertising landscape. Improvements in technology and mass production, coupled with the growth of metropolitan centers, created brand-new opportunities for services to reach bigger audiences. Key milestones in the birth of modern advertising include:

  • Newspapers and Magazines: With the rise of industrialization and the printing press, papers and magazines emerged as popular advertising platforms. Services began placing paid ads in publications, targeting specific demographics based upon readership.
  • Branding and Logos: As competition increased, companies recognized the need for distinction. They started adopting logos and slogans to develop brand identities that consumers might acknowledge and trust.
  •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the first ad agency were developed, marking a shift from private companies managing their promotions to specific companies providing advertising services. These firms brought a more tactical and innovative approach to advertising.

Search Engine Marketing (SEM)

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a type of paid advertising that intends to increase a website's exposure on search engine results pages (SERPs). It involves bidding on particular keywords relevant to the business, and when users search for those keywords, the ads appear at the top or bottom of the search results. SEM can be extremely effective as it targets users actively looking for product and services associated with the advertiser's offerings. Google Ads (formerly known as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, however other search engines like Bing likewise provide similar advertising chances.

Programmatic Advertising

Programmatic advertising is a prime example of how information and technology have transformed the advertising landscape. This automated technique to advertisement purchasing utilizes algorithms and real-time bidding to buy ad space on digital platforms. It makes it possible for marketers to target particular audiences at the right moment with extremely pertinent ads, taking full advantage of the chances of engagement and conversion.

Programmatic advertising simplifies the ad-buying process, reducing human intervention and enhancing performance. With data-backed insights, advertisers can identify the most appealing advertisement positionings, enhance advertisement performance, and achieve a higher return on investment (ROI).
